Buying TREE with Tether36
TREEP plans to create a content platform where users can purchase, sell, and stream video content as TREE tokens. TREE uses blockchain technology to securely manage and track content and ensure fair compensation for creators.
Tether is a stablecoin pegged to the US dollar, making it a convenient and low-volatility option for purchasing cryptocurrencies like TREE. Here's a step-by-step guide on how to buy TREE with Tether:
1. Choose a Cryptocurrency Exchange
Several cryptocurrency exchanges allow you to buy TREE with Tether. Some popular options include:* Binance
* KuCoin
* Huobi Global
2. Create an Account
Visit the website of your chosen exchange and create an account. You will need to provide personal information, such as your name, email address, and phone number. You may also need to verify your identity by submitting a government-issued ID.
3. Deposit Tether
Once your account is created, you need to deposit Tether into it. You can do this by transferring Tether from another wallet or by purchasing Tether with a credit or debit card.
4. Find the TREE/USDT Trading Pair
On the exchange's trading platform, find the trading pair for TREE/USDT. This will show you the current price of TREE in Tether.
5. Place a Buy Order
Enter the amount of Tether you want to spend on TREE and the price you want to buy it at. You can choose between different types of orders, such as market orders (which execute immediately at the current market price) or limit orders (which only execute when the price reaches a specified level).
6. Review and Confirm
Review the details of your order, including the amount of Tether you are spending, the price you are buying TREE at, and the estimated number of TREE tokens you will receive. Once you are satisfied with the order, confirm it.
7. Store Your TREE
Once your order is executed, your TREE tokens will be deposited into your exchange wallet. You can then withdraw them to a private wallet for safekeeping or hold them on the exchange.
Benefits of Buying TREE with Tether* Stability: Tether is a stablecoin pegged to the US dollar, which means its value is much less volatile than many other cryptocurrencies. This makes it a more reliable option for purchasing TREE.
* Convenience: Tether is widely accepted on cryptocurrency exchanges, making it easy to buy and sell TREE.
* Low Fees: Many exchanges offer low fees for trading Tether, making it a cost-effective way to purchase TREE.
Risks of Buying TREE with Tether* Volatility: While Tether is a stablecoin, the price of TREE can still fluctuate significantly. This means you could lose money if the price of TREE drops after you purchase it.
* Security: Cryptocurrency exchanges can be targets for hackers, so it is important to choose a reputable exchange and take steps to secure your account.
* Regulatory Uncertainty: The regulatory landscape for cryptocurrencies is still evolving, and it is possible that new regulations could impact the availability or price of TREE.
